Fourth-year attacker from Rockville Centre, NY... Born June 17, 1989... Plans to major in Education.
AS A SOPHOMORE (2009):
Played in 14 of Iona's 15 games, making nine starts... Had six games with multiple goals, including a season-high five at Long Island (3/24) and four at Canisius (4/3)... Scored in each of the Gaels' final four contests... Finished fourth on the team in points (24), goals (20), shots (43), and shots on goal (32)... Her 20 goals included two game-winners... Added six ground balls, five draw controls, and two caused turnovers.
AS A FRESHMAN (2008):
Appeared in 16 games...Registered first collegiate goal and assist at Quinnipiac (2/27)...Scored two goals and added an assist vs. Sacred Heart (3/5)...Scored two goals and provided two assists vs. Longwood (3/28)...Scored two goals, on two shots on goal, at Monmouth (3/30)...Provided an assist at Lafayette (4/2).
BEFORE IONA:
Three sport letter winner in soccer, basketball, and lacrosse at Oceanside HS and served as team captain of all three sports as a senior... Named All-Conference in basketball in 2006-07, leading the squad in points and assists... All-Nassau County as a junior and senior year in lacrosse. Led the team in goals and points in 2006 and as in her final year led the squad in goals, assists and points... Played for the Long Island Liberty Lacrosse Club.... Nominated for the Oceanside HS Hall of Fame in 2006 and 2007... Awarded the Ruth Lewis Female Athlete of the Year from Oceanside High School... Served as her class Vice President as a junior and the Student Body Vice President as a senior.
